Mountain Province recovers 84.65 carat and 53.90 carat diamonds from Gahcho Kue

Mountain Province Diamonds Inc. has recovered during April 2017 an 84.65 carat and 53.90 carat gem quality diamond from the Gahcho Kue diamond mine. The joint venture partners bid for the production of fancy coloured and special (+10.8 carat) diamonds on almost a monthly basis. The bid for April 2017 production of fancies and specials was won by Mountain Province and included the two exceptional diamonds.

The fancies and specials are now owned by Mountain Province and will be included in the company’s upcoming sales through its broker in Antwerp, Belgium.

Mountain Province President and CEO Patrick Evans commented: “The 84.65 carat diamond is the largest gem quality diamond recovered to date and provides further confirmation that Gahcho Kué hosts a population of large, high quality gem diamonds. The 53.90 carat diamond is the highest quality exceptional stone recovered to date and is expected to achieve a record price at tender.”
